Alluva sudden, my Module Administration page won't scroll down enough to show uninstalled modules -- it shows what's installed then stops scrolling at the Module/Version/Action header, atop where the uninstalled modules should be. I've tried this on different browsers on different computers, so it's definitely a XOOPS thing (2.0.14). Any ideas as to what happened and how I can fix this "short" page?

I discovered the problem. It was caused by having a pending newbb module waiting to be installed. My 2.0.14 apparently has a reference to modules\newbb somewhere and was trying to load data from an uninstalled module. Removing the newbb folder solved the problem.
